2. Scite: Intelligent Citation Analysis

scite

Scite introduces a novel perspective on citation analysis through its AI-driven platform, which indexes over 1 billion citations and 100 million papers. Its prominent feature, Smart Citations, transcends conventional metrics by revealing whether a source supports, opposes, or merely references a study. This advancement accelerates literature reviews and enhances the precision of research evaluations.
For researchers inundated with vast amounts of academic work, Scite's emphasis on citation context aids in producing more informed and credible research. It alters the perception of citations, providing insights that delve deeper than mere citation counts.
The platform also addresses challenges such as citation bias and source reliability by analyzing citations within their appropriate context, which is particularly advantageous for literature reviews and evaluating research impact.

Here's what Scite offers to enhance your research process:

FeatureWhat It Does
Smart CitationsReveals the context of citations
Citation ClassificationCategorizes citations by type
Integration OptionsCollaborates with popular reference tools
Citation Network AnalysisVisualizes research connections

Utilizing machine learning, Scite assesses how citations contribute to the broader academic discourse. By examining patterns and contexts, researchers can evaluate source reliability and establish their work on credible foundations.
Scite is accessible through both free and premium options, making advanced citation tools available to a diverse user base. It's especially beneficial for researchers seeking to comprehend the genuine impact and context of academic sources, offering significantly more than just a citation tally.

3. Semantic Scholar: Research Paper Discovery

semantic scholar

Semantic Scholar, developed by the Allen Institute for AI, is a robust platform for locating and exploring academic research. With a repository of over 200 million papers, it stands out as a primary resource for comprehensive literature reviews, thanks to its AI-enhanced search functionalities.
What distinguishes Semantic Scholar is its ranking algorithm, which evaluates multiple factors to deliver precise and relevant outcomes:

FeaturePurpose
Citation AnalysisMonitors citation patterns to identify influential studies
Content UnderstandingUtilizes NLP to enhance search accuracy
Topic ModelingConnects related research through topic relationships
Paper SummarizationProvides concise summaries to expedite reviews

Whether you're a student embarking on your first literature review or a researcher tracking the latest trends, Semantic Scholar simplifies the process. In contrast to platforms like Scite, which prioritize citation contexts, Semantic Scholar excels at uncovering research trends and identifying gaps in the literature.
In fields such as biomedical research, Semantic Scholar has demonstrated its utility by analyzing co-citation networks, assisting researchers in recognizing connections and opportunities for further inquiry.
The platform is particularly effective for spotting research gaps, comprehending intellectual frameworks, monitoring trends, and evaluating source credibility. Its summarization tool offers swift insights into papers, enabling researchers to efficiently ascertain the relevance of a study before committing to a full read.
Best of all, Semantic Scholar is free, making advanced research tools widely accessible. It integrates with various databases and tools, further enhancing its utility. However, it is advisable to verify AI-generated summaries against the original papers to ensure accuracy.
Regular updates keep the platform's AI tools and database current, maintaining its competitive edge in academic research.

5. Elicit: AI for Research Questions

elicit

Elicit leverages AI to refine how researchers formulate questions and discover relevant studies, even in the absence of specific keywords. This makes it an indispensable tool for revealing connections in interdisciplinary research and literature exploration.

The tool focuses on three primary functions:

FunctionWhat It DoesWhy It's Useful
Smart SearchIdentifies relevant studies without precise keywordsUncovers research that might otherwise be overlooked
Targeted SummariesExtracts information tailored to specific research questionsAccelerates the literature review process
Data ExtractionGathers essential statistics and findings from papersFacilitates comparison of results across studies

Elicit excels in analyzing academic literature and transforming broad research concepts into clear, actionable inquiries. For instance, if you're investigating how climate change impacts biodiversity, Elicit can swiftly highlight statistical patterns and experimental results from a variety of studies, assisting you in directing your investigation.
It also collaborates effectively with other research tools. While platforms like Semantic Scholar are adept at mapping research landscapes, Elicit concentrates on specific data points and relationships that can steer your study. Furthermore, it pairs seamlessly with summarization tools like Paper Digest, crafting a more comprehensive research experience.
For optimal workflow, pair Elicit with writing tools like Julius or Paperguide. This combination addresses everything from developing research questions to drafting a polished academic paper. Elicit is particularly advantageous for systematic reviews, interdisciplinary projects, and analyzing quantitative data, especially in emerging fields or when comparing findings across diverse studies.

6. Julius: Academic Writing Assistance

julius

Julius employs advanced AI models such as GPT-4 and Claude to assist with academic writing at every phase, from drafting to refinement. It is designed to streamline the creation of research documents with tools that cater to various aspects of the process.
Here's what Julius excels at:

  • Enhances writing by checking grammar, improving style, and clarifying content.
  • Automatically formats citations and tracks sources, seamlessly incorporating these features into your workflow.
  • Refines content to help produce well-organized research papers across diverse fields.

One notable feature is Advanced Reasoning, which simplifies intricate academic concepts into easily comprehensible explanations. It also processes research data by generating visual representations and interpreting statistical findings, making it an excellent choice for tackling interdisciplinary projects.
Julius accommodates multiple file formats, including PDFs, images, and CSV files, providing flexibility to its functionality. It also allows users to pose research-specific questions and delivers clear, academically-focused responses to strengthen arguments and enhance writing.
Pricing ranges from $20 to $70 per month, with higher tiers offering advanced tools and collaborative features. This makes it suitable for both individual researchers and academic teams.
Julius is particularly beneficial for researchers handling complex datasets or operating across different fields, thanks to its integration of writing tools and data analysis capabilities. 9. Scholarcy: Research Paper Summarization

scholarcy

Scholarcy is an AI-driven tool designed to streamline the process of reading and analyzing research papers. It generates concise summaries of complex studies, facilitating literature reviews and highlighting key points. Beyond summarization, Scholarcy also extracts references, figures, and methodologies, providing users with deeper insights into the content.

Here's what Scholarcy offers:

FeatureFunctionResearch Benefit
Smart SummarizationCondenses lengthy papers into main ideasAccelerates literature review process
Reference ExtractionAutomatically gathers citationsSimplifies bibliography creation
Figure DetectionIdentifies charts and tablesProvides quick access to data
Multi-language SupportAccommodates English, Spanish, French, and German contentEnhances global research efforts

It also integrates seamlessly with tools like Zotero and Mendeley for managing citations, simplifying bibliography creation. Scholarcy works effectively alongside other platforms like Trinka AI, which focuses on enhancing writing, and Semantic Scholar, which aids in discovering relevant studies.
Scholarcy is particularly advantageous for processing substantial volumes of research. It identifies methodologies, findings, and conclusions, ensuring you don't overlook significant details.
Here's how to optimize your use of Scholarcy:

  • Start Broad: Utilize it to quickly scan multiple papers and identify those worthy of a deeper examination.
  • Extract References: Build comprehensive bibliographies with its reference extraction feature.
  • Compare Insights: Use summaries to cross-reference findings across various studies.

Scholarcy provides a free version for basic needs, as well as a premium option for those requiring advanced tools and heightened processing limits.

10. ExplainPaper: Making Research Papers Easier to Understand

explain paper

ExplainPaper assists in making intricate academic papers more accessible by breaking down challenging concepts into clear, comprehensible explanations. Its primary feature? Allowing users to interact directly with perplexing sections of research papers.
Here's how it operates: upload your paper, highlight the confusing parts, and the AI delivers concise, accurate explanations. This facilitates easier navigation through dense academic content.

Key Features of ExplainPaper

FeaturePurposeBenefit
Interactive HighlightingIdentifies perplexing sectionsGains clarity on specific challenging areas
Jargon SimplificationSimplifies complex terminologyQuickly comprehends specialized terms
Context-Aware ExplanationsProvides field-specific insightsEnhances understanding of subject-specific content
Cross-Discipline SupportOperates across multiple research domainsUseful for interdisciplinary studies

ExplainPaper is particularly beneficial for interdisciplinary research, where unfamiliar terms from diverse fields can impede progress. It integrates smoothly into research workflows, emphasizing understanding rather than merely summarizing.
Tips for Optimizing ExplainPaper:

  • Start with Core Ideas: Identify and clarify main terms or concepts initially.
  • Utilize Contextual Insights: Allow the AI to elucidate how specific terms fit into the broader context.
  • Double-Check Explanations: Compare the AI's breakdown with the original text to ensure accuracy.

Unlike tools such as Scholarcy, which summarize entire papers, ExplainPaper focuses on specific challenging sections. This makes it a valuable companion for tools that handle summarization or discovery. It supports a wide array of fields, including physics, biology, engineering, and social sciences, bridging understanding gaps and facilitating the research process.
